Springfield’s refreshed SAINT Victor V2 lineup (5.56 and 7.62) rolls in with upgraded barrels, controls, and furniture—aimed at home-defense AR buyers and range regulars who want premium touches without boutique prices.

Springfield Armory announced on September 2, 2025 a broad update to the SAINT Victor family—now commonly referred to as the V2 update. The refresh spans multiple SKUs (11.5″, 14″, and 16″ in 5.56; 16″ and 20″ in 7.62/.308), bringing enhanced components across the board and MSRPs that stay in the same ballpark as the outgoing generation. What’s New vs. Prior Model

  • Receivers & Fit: Forged 7075-T6 upper/lower with Accu-Tite tension system for a snug, accuracy-friendly receiver fit.
  • Controls: Radian Raptor-LT ambi charging handle standard; 45° ambi safeties across rifles.
  • Barrel Package: 4150 CMV, tapered profile, nitride finish, pinned/welded device on the 14″ 5.56 to legal 16″; gas lengths tuned by model.
  • Handguard: Free-floated aluminum with full top Pic rail, T-slot markings, M-LOK throughout, plus four integrated QD cups.
  • Bolt Carrier Group: M16-pattern carrier, 9310 bolt (HP/MPI), nitride, hard-chromed firing pin, properly staked key.
  • Furniture & Trigger: B5 SOPMOD stock, Type 23 P-Grip, low-pro flip-ups, nickel boron-coated trigger; .308 and color variants (Black, Coyote Brown, Tungsten Gray) added.
  • Lineup Size: Broad rollout (~16 SKUs) across 5.56 and 7.62 families.

Use Cases

If you want a defensive AR that’s ready on Day 1, the V2 checks boxes: reliable BCG, quality barrel steel, ambi charging handle, and practical furniture out of the gate. For home defense, the 11.5″ pistol/SBR configurations keep things compact; for range or patrol carbine roles, the 14″/16″ 5.56 models balance recoil, velocity, and handling. Hunters or .308 fans can lean into the 7.62 variants for heavier hitting power with tuned gas lengths. (Translation: you don’t have to play armorer the minute it arrives.)
